Fans of the iconic gaming franchise will need to exercise patience, as Rockstar Games has officially confirmed a slight postponement for the highly anticipated Grand Theft Auto VI. The legendary video game developer announced that the game's release will now be pushed to May 2026, extending the wait for eager gamers worldwide.
In a statement addressing the delay, Rockstar Games emphasized their unwavering commitment to delivering an exceptional gaming experience that surpasses player expectations. The additional development time will allow the studio to refine and polish every aspect of the game, ensuring that Grand Theft Auto VI meets the incredibly high standards set by its predecessors.
